I used to watch this show at my grandma and grandpa's house when I was a child. I used to believe it was "real" but when I was older I realized it was not. It tackled some controversial topics, however, and I would like to view some of these episodes again. Here are the episodes I can remember.
* An episode that dealt with two boys who had played blood brothers and one had HIV/AIDS.
* An episode where a young man took the courtroom hostage and the judge talked him down explaining that he knew what it felt like to be shot, in a war I believe. If memory serves, the young man turned the gun on himself, but never went through with the act.
* An episode involving a child supposedly bearing the mark of the beast.
